Next Generation Supplier Arrangement (NGSA)
• Through NGSA, we are transforming the way we work with
suppliers and modernising our approach
• Current WEM framework is coming to a close
• New Collaborative Delivery Framework (schemes £250k to
£50m) and specialist frameworks
• 6 Collaborative delivery teams nationally, each team
will include Environment Agency and delivery partner
staff
• There will be a separately appointed consultant and
contractor in each team
• Tender process is being finalised and the outcome is
due in March 2019
• RMA’s will be able to use the Framework – if
required – separate details to be issued

Environment Agency Port Clarence and Greatham South
• Overall costs c£15m – approx. £1.7m under the original contract value.
• Protects 350 residential properties and major infrastructure, includes 36ha
of intertidal habitat with 12ha of freshwater habitat
• 0.5%AEP standard of protection, including 50yrs of Climate Change
• Officially opened November 2018

Whitby Piers
• Voiding, undermining
• Sheet piles, grouting
• 362 OM3s, 14 OM2s
• Cost - £9,001k – funding secure • FDGiA - £4,812k
• ESIF - £2,700k
• LEP - £500k
• NYCC – 489k
• SBC - £500k
• Currently demobilised from site for the winter period – remobilise again in March.
• Works continuing whilst offsite include: • Final elements of design being completed
• Planning methods & temporary works design
• Permitting & planning activities
![Page 16: North East Coastal Group · emergency repairs (Southern Breakwater) • 54 Properties Better Protected . Yorkshire Area Coastal Update ... Scarborough Spa • Cliff Instability •](https://reader033.vdocuments.site/reader033/viewer/2022050310/5f724fd65f31467d9023dc46/html5/thumbnails/16.jpg)
Whitby Church St. • Elevated water levels in River Esk due to
tides & storm surges pose flooding risk along Church St.
• 54 residential & 8 commercial properties
• Designed to 1 in 100 S.O.P.
• Planning approved. SBC Cabinet approval 12.02.19.
• Cost - £2,094k – funding providers: • LEP - £1,100k
• GiA - £672k
• Local Levy – 246k
• SBC - £61k
• NYCC - £15k
• Construction start March 2019, end October 2019.
![Page 17: North East Coastal Group · emergency repairs (Southern Breakwater) • 54 Properties Better Protected . Yorkshire Area Coastal Update ... Scarborough Spa • Cliff Instability •](https://reader033.vdocuments.site/reader033/viewer/2022050310/5f724fd65f31467d9023dc46/html5/thumbnails/17.jpg)
Scarborough Spa
• Cliff Instability
• 380 properties- coastal erosion
• Piling, soil nailing, drainage, regrading
• Cost - £15,909k • FDGiA - £ 11,619k
• SBC/NYCC - £2,290k
• Risk - £2,000k
• Started on site mid-May, completion end 2019.
• 94% of soil nails & 25% of piles installed so far
• Over £2.1m of efficiencies accepted in Q3

SOUTH FERRIBY Flood Alleviation Scheme
• Full BC assured. FSoD expected Feb 2019 - £11.8m Capital
• Includes defence realignment – future sustainability
• Planning Application – determination by 22 March by NLC
• Enabling works winter 2018/19. Works Spring 2019
• £5.9m contributions reduce need for GiA from £8m to £5.9m
• Further funding bids being pursued to reduce GiA further –
£0.6m HE, £0.25m Lottery Fund, £0.25m AWS & LEP LGF?
• Strong partnership with CEMEX: 60,000 tonnes clay
stockpiled so far.

Saltfleet to Gibraltar Point Strategy Review
• Feb 2018 - public consultation: • Preferred option – Beach with control structures • Reduces long-term sand volume and frequency
• PFCalc > 100% FCRM GiA…. but: • Affordability implications • Programme delivery challenges
• Spring 2019: Draft Strategy consultation
• 2020/2021: LPRG approval
• 2021 and beyond – delivery of on site works
• Up to 2021 – Lincolnshire Beach
Management 3 year contract to continue
(annual sand re-nourishment)
• 2019 campaign from May (Brexit permitting)

South Humber bank – 2021+ pipeline projects
Immingham - Freshney (£6.5M) • Along 7.0km - >5000 prop’s & >£1Bn industry
• Asset strengthening and refurbishment
• Considering 4 MR and IDB outfalls
Barton to New Holland & Barton ‘west’ (£15-20M) • Combined appraisal – joint benefits/outcomes 1500+ properties
• Habitat and recreation challenges and opportunities
• Barrow Haven outfall – highest risk but low BCR on own
Cleethorpes - Humberston (£4.0M+) • >1700 properties and economic benefits
• With NELC to reduce risk to tourism amenities
• Various strategic options being considered
• Private caravan and chalet parks = contributions?
Halton Marshes phase 2 (£4.0M+) • Realigned defence at existing Ro-Ro port complex
• With NLC to enable growth and development
• Significant contributions likely to be needed

Background
• Change to SMP Policy Unit P
- current – hold the line
- acceleration of policy in Epoch 3
• Tidal Surge of December 2013
- 400m cross bank breached in 5 locations
- tidal surge in excess of 0.5% design tide
- no properties were flooded
Tidal inundation
Dec 2013
![Page 26: North East Coastal Group · emergency repairs (Southern Breakwater) • 54 Properties Better Protected . Yorkshire Area Coastal Update ... Scarborough Spa • Cliff Instability •](https://reader033.vdocuments.site/reader033/viewer/2022050310/5f724fd65f31467d9023dc46/html5/thumbnails/26.jpg)
Partnership working
• Natural England & Lincs Wildlife Trust
- located in Gibraltar Point SSSI/SPA/Ramsar/SAC
- Gibraltar Point Coastal Wetland Adaptation Study
- 2014 repaired low spots in dune system
- under Natural England licence
- continued protection to Aylmer Avenue
• Consultation with SMP partners
- Lincolnshire County Council
![Page 27: North East Coastal Group · emergency repairs (Southern Breakwater) • 54 Properties Better Protected . Yorkshire Area Coastal Update ... Scarborough Spa • Cliff Instability •](https://reader033.vdocuments.site/reader033/viewer/2022050310/5f724fd65f31467d9023dc46/html5/thumbnails/27.jpg)
Current Situation
• Low spots to back bank filled in 2014 - repaired to design tidal defence standard
• Modelling highlighted no risk to properties - overtopping migrates into tidal floodplain
- local area can accommodate flows
• Options considered (a) repair (Est. £70,000)
(b) replace (Est. £300,000)
(c) move defence line to Western dune
(d) move defence line / revise flood warning thresholds
• Promoted approach - option (c) is preferred with (d) instigated short term
![Page 28: North East Coastal Group · emergency repairs (Southern Breakwater) • 54 Properties Better Protected . Yorkshire Area Coastal Update ... Scarborough Spa • Cliff Instability •](https://reader033.vdocuments.site/reader033/viewer/2022050310/5f724fd65f31467d9023dc46/html5/thumbnails/28.jpg)
Benefits • Restoration of brackish habitat
• May reduce the future SMP risks of coastal squeeze
Future outlook
• Agreement from NECG
• Approach RFCC – April 2019
